Create an easy, floral accent to brighten any outfit, from an old, wool sweater.

Instructions

STEP 1:

Wash in hot water and dry a 100% wool sweater.

STEP 2:

Cut 2 strips of wool scraps, approximately 1 1/2 inches wide and stitch them together near the bottom of the strip.

STEP 3:

Cut fringe along the sweater strip. Don't go through the stitched line.

STEP 4:

Cut a felt circle and coil the fringed strip of sweater. Add glue as you coil it to create a mum like flower.

STEP 5:

Place a button, covered brad, or an old earring for the center of the flower.

STEP 6:

Add felt leaves and some hand stitching to accent the leaves.

STEP 7:

Glue a pin to back for wearing the flower.
